Explore this online map, zoom into your community, use the tools to identify intergenerational resources/projects and create or join related discussions.
i2i has partnered with a Geoide project led by Ryerson University, to provide this online mapping tool for gathering information from you on Intergenerational resources and projects in communities across Canada.
